diff options
Diffstat (limited to 'source/blender/blenkernel/intern/pointcache.c')
-rw-r--r-- | source/blender/blenkernel/intern/pointcache.c |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/source/blender/blenkernel/intern/pointcache.c b/source/blender/blenkernel/intern/pointcache.c index 063a81e6efb..a6a7664ec61 100644 --- a/source/blender/blenkernel/intern/pointcache.c +++ b/source/blender/blenkernel/intern/pointcache.c @@ -85,11 +85,12 @@ #ifdef WITH_LZO #include "minilzo.h" -#else -/* used for non-lzo cases */ -#define LZO_OUT_LEN(size) ((size) + (size) / 16 + 64 + 3) +#define LZO_HEAP_ALLOC(var,size) \ + lzo_align_t __LZO_MMODEL var [ ((size) + (sizeof(lzo_align_t) - 1)) / sizeof(lzo_align_t) ] #endif +#define LZO_OUT_LEN(size) ((size) + (size) / 16 + 64 + 3) + #ifdef WITH_LZMA #include "LzmaLib.h" #endif |